Understanding Lambeth's Neighbourhoods


Lambeth is a rich tapestry of different neighbourhoods, each with its unique charm and characteristics. From the bustling streets of Brixton to the serene River Thames views in Waterloo, here's a brief overview of several key areas:




    • Brixton: Known for its lively arts scene and diverse culture. Popular among young professionals.

    • Clapham: Offers a blend of trendy cafes, bars, and green spaces. Great for families and young couples.

    • Kennington: Offers historical charm with its Georgian architecture. Ideal for professionals working in central London.

    • Streatham: A more affordable area with good transport links. Suitable for first-time buyers.

Market Trends and Prices


The property market in Lambeth has seen significant fluctuations, influenced by various factors like economic changes, government policies, and even global events. As of the latest data, the average house price in Lambeth is over ?600,000. Here's a more detailed breakdown:




    • Detached Houses: Typically range from ?1 million to ?2 million.

    • Semi-Detached Houses: Average around ?800,000 to ?1 million.

    • Terraced Houses: Priced between ?600,000 and ?800,000.

    • Flats: Usually range from ?300,000 to ?600,000.



Key Factors Impacting Real Estate


Several factors play a crucial role in shaping Lambeth's real estate market. These factors can help you make a more informed decision:




    • Transport Links: Proximity to Tube stations and bus routes can significantly affect property prices.

    • Amenity Access: Proximity to schools, parks, hospitals, and shopping centres can influence property value.

    • Development Projects: Ongoing and upcoming development projects can boost property values in specific areas.

    • Historical Significance: Areas with historical landmarks often see a price premium.



Tips for Buyers


Buying property can be a daunting process, especially in a dynamic market like Lambeth. Here are some tips to help you navigate the process:




    • Do Your Research: Understand the market trends and property prices in various neighbourhoods.

    • Get Pre-Approved: Secure a mortgage pre-approval to streamline the buying process.

    • Work with Local Agents: Leverage their local knowledge and expertise to find hidden gems.

    • Be Ready to Act Quick: Desirable properties in prime locations move quickly, so be prepared to make a swift decision.



Pros and Cons of Lambeth Real Estate


As with any investment, it's essential to consider the pros and cons:




    Pros:



        • - Diverse neighbourhoods catering to different lifestyles.

        • - Excellent transport links to central London.

        • - Rich cultural and historical significance.

        • - Strong potential for property value appreciation.



      Cons:



          • - High property prices compared to other London boroughs.

          • - Competitive market where desirable properties can move quickly.

          • - Potential for noise and congestion in busier areas.
